Eni is a multinational oil and gas company involved in the exploration, production, refining, and distribution of energy resources across several countries worldwide. Founded in Italy, Eni operates in both traditional and renewable energy sectors, focusing on oil, natural gas, biofuels, and sustainable energy solutions. The company is committed to innovation, energy efficiency, and reducing environmental impact through investments in cleaner technologies and low-carbon initiatives. With a strong global presence and partnerships in regions such as Africa, Europe, and the Middle East, Eni continues to play an important role in meeting global energy demands while supporting the transition toward a more sustainable energy future.

Job Title: Manager Energy Law
Job Description:
- At Eni, we are looking for an Energy Law Manager within Nigerian Agip Exploration Ltd in Abuja, Nigeria. You will be responsible for providing legal assistance, advice and support to NAE and Eni’s subsidiaries in Nigeria in both internal and external processes, covering contractual, administrative, judicial and extrajudicial matters, in accordance with applicable laws and the policies, rules and procedures established by the Company.
Main Responsibilities
- Support company departments with timely advice on all legal matters relating to contracts, licences, commercial agreements, portfolio management activities (e.g. M&A, farm‑out/in activities), governance and corporate secretarial matters, as well as applicable laws and regulations.
- Support company departments in attending meetings with third parties and governmental authorities in relation to NAE’s activities in Nigeria.
- Participate in ad hoc working groups with internal and/or external parties.
- Manage and engage on relevant legal issues with industry stakeholders and partners.
- Manage legal representation and defence in relation to disputes and litigation, including the management of external legal providers and the assessment of the quality of the contributions received.
- Liaise with external legal providers appointed by NAE and Eni’s subsidiaries in Nigeria and/or in relation to NAE’s activities in Nigeria.
- Regularly liaise with the Eni Legal Department, ensuring the prompt reporting of all relevant legal issues.
